RECOMMENDED System Requirements
OS: Windows XP/Vista
Processor: Intel Core 2 Duo @ 2.66Ghz
Memory: 2 Gb
Video Memory: 512 Mb
Video Card: nVidia GeForce 8800 / ATI Radeon 3800

Most branded prebuilts that do not come with video cards like yours, usually have a power supply that will limit your upgrade options. This is a good time to open up your desktop PC and look at the wattage rating on that power supply. Powerful video cards will require a power supply upgrade in most cases.
